Training Wraps – Handwraps are extremely important as they protect your hand and wrist from injuries while hitting a heavy bag or sparring.

Gloves – There are three types one can choose – boxing, training bag, or grappling gloves. Which one to choose depends on your training objectives.

Mouth Guards – Mouth guards are used to protect your teeth and gums. Unfortunately, most mouth guards do not fit well since everyone has different sizes and shapes of teeth. Custom mouth guards available, but they are quite expensive to produce.

Headgear – As kicks, elbows, and knees are used in Muay Thai, headgear is critical in protecting the ears, cheeks, and forehead.

Jockstrap – For male fighters, this is a wise investment during sparring, and absolute must if one is competing. A misplaces leg kick or knee can bring a world of pain.

Good Mesh Ventilation Designs for Tennis Shoes

Shoes & Footwear in HOBART (TAS) : AussieWeb Local Search One important and often overlooked aspect to shoe design is the breathability. Many tennis shoes suffer from poor ventilation, which causes the sweat to be locked inside the shoe with nowhere else to go. Without proper holes or mesh the sweat has no escape and can collect in the shoe and socks. This is uncomfortable for the player and really should not happen in a good tennis shoe design.

Some of the most popular ventilation solutions for tennis shoes include either holes or mesh. In general the holes are very small and do not actually appear to go all the way through the material, but it functions well to allow the sweat out. Mesh patterns are the most effective way for a shoe to ventilate because the holes are very small, but still cover a very large area.
